WebGASB defines a lease this way: A lease is defined as a contract that conveys control of the right to use another entity’s nonfinancial asset (the underlying asset) as specified in the contract for a period of time in an … WebThese interest rates are the internal rate of return on all payments or receipts related to the lease. GASB 87, Paragraph B40, specifies that the lessor will apply the interest rate it charges the lessee. This rate is stated in the lease or is an implicit interest rate. ... Step 1: Calculate straight … WebOn April 1, 2013, the City issued $36.3 million in gas tax special revenue refunding bonds with interest rates ranging between 2.75% and 5.25%. The City issued the bonds to advance refund $31.6 million of the outstanding series 2006 special revenue bonds with a 7.2% interest rate. in tv new shows
